Пример #1
0
 @Test
 public void testDistanceToCentroid() throws Exception {
   ArrayList<Circle> circles = Grid.linearGrid(1, Point.create(0, 0), 1, 0);
   Polygon polygon = AdapterUtil.polygon(new GeometryFactory(), circles.get(0), 5);
   PreferredZone preferredZone = new PreferredZone(polygon, 0.5);
   Assert.assertEquals(
       1.5,
       preferredZone.distanceToCentroid(new GeometryFactory().createPoint(new Coordinate(2, 0))),
       DoubleUtil.eps);
 }